Programs
- Parents/Guardians (at least fourteen (14) years of age) must accompany children under ten (10) years of age to the program area for drop-off and pick-up.
- Children under ten (10) years of age do not need to be accompanied throughout the program (unless otherwise stated) however, the parent/guardian must remain in the building for the duration of the program (programs in excess of two (2) consecutive hours excluded).
Memberships
- Annual memberships are valid for one (1) year from the start date.
- Punch Passes are valid through to the end date on the purchase receipt.
- Membership holders are required to present your membership card upon arrival at a recreation facility for validation.
- Memberships may not be shared or transferred with anyone; it is for the sole use of the recipient.
- "Teen" refers to those individuals 14-17 years of age. Teens are required to participate in a consultation session prior to activating their membership.
- "Students" refer to any full-time student 18-54 years of age with presentation of a current student identification card.
- Suspension requests are subject to an administration fee and are offered in any duration up to a maximum of forty-two (42) days (six (6) weeks) provided that the requested length does not exceed the remaining length of time left on the membership.
- Extensions for regularly scheduled and communicated shutdowns (e.g. annual maintenance) at a facility will not be considered. Alternate locations for membership access are available.
Personal Training
- Clients must complete and sign a medical questionnaire before commencing personal training.
- Personal training packages are valid for one (1) year from the displayed start date.
- Clients must verify completion of each personal training session with their signature, date and time in their folder and Personal Training Logbook.
- Personal training sessions that are not rescheduled or cancelled twenty-four (24) hours in advance, will result in a forfeiture of the session.
- Clients who arrive late for a scheduled session, will only receive the remaining scheduled session time.
- Every effort will be made to provide clients with a personal trainer of their choice however management reserves the right to substitute another qualified personal trainer if and when necessary.
